Optimizing training sets for genomic selection to identify superior genotypes across multiple environments.
G3 (Bethesda, Md.) - 1 Apr 2026
Liu Zi-Jie, Liao Chen-Tuo
Abstract excerpt
Genomic selection (GS) is a promising strategy in plant breeding for identifying superior genotypes with high true breeding values (TBVs) across multiple environments. However, the relative performance of candidate genotypes often varies due to complex genotype-by-environment (G × E) interactions in multienvironment trials (METs). To address this challenge, we employed a GS prediction model incorporating fixed...
